Rim or disc brakes? You will need some adapters to use 700c rims in a frame with brake bosses for 26" wheels. You will need to consider rim width and tyre volume a bit too, but plenty of people have done this before.
If you find some cheapy disc hub wheels for hybrid bikes and the rear hub is only 130 mm, [url= http://www.sheldonbrown.com/frame-spacing.html ]sheldon brown[/url] has some advice about spacing out a 130mm hub to go into 135mm dropouts.
